A restaurant has 4 pizza toppings to choose from. How many different 3 topping pizzas are possible
Using combinations in mathematics, it's found that there are 4 different 3-topping pizzas possible from a selection of 4 toppings, since the order of toppings on a pizza does not matter.
Explanation:Combination Calculation for Pizza Toppings
When considering the number of different 3-topping pizzas possible from 4 choices, one must use combinations to solve this problem. A combination is a selection of items where the order does not matter, which fits our scenario since the order of toppings on a pizza does not change the pizza's identity. In mathematical terms, we look for the number of combinations of 4 items taken 3 at a time, which is denoted as 4C3.
The formula for combinations is:
C(n, k) = n! / (k!(n-k)!), where n is the total number of items, k is the number of items to choose, and ! denotes a factorial.
Thus, for our pizza topping problem, this becomes:
4C3 = 4! / (3!(4-3)!) = (4×3×2×1) / ((3×2×1)×1) = 24 / 6 = 4 different 3-topping pizzas.
Therefore, there are 4 different ways to select 3 toppings from a choice of 4.

1. What is the percent change from 1000 to 80?
2. What is the percent change from 45 to 63?
3. What is the percent change from 250 to 60?
4. What is the percent change from 60 to 99?
Step-by-step explanation:
1.-92%
2.40%
3.-76%
4.65%
The percent changes for each scenario is: 1. From 1000 to 80: -92% 2. From 45 to 63: +40% 3. From 250 to 60: -76% 4. From 60 to 99: +65%.
To calculate the percent change between two values, we use the formula:
[tex]\[ \text{Percent Change} = \left( \frac{\text{New Value} - \text{Original Value}}{\text{Original Value}} \right) \times 100\% \][/tex]
1. The percent change from 1000 to 80 is calculated as follows:
[tex]\[ \text{Percent Change} = \left( \frac{80 - 1000}{1000} \right) \times 100\% = \left( \frac{-920}{1000} \right) \times 100\% = -92\% \][/tex]
So, the percent change is a 92% decrease.
2. The percent change from 45 to 63 is calculated as follows:
[tex]\[ \text{Percent Change} = \left( \frac{63 - 45}{45} \right) \times 100\% = \left( \frac{18}{45} \right) \times 100\% = \frac{2}{5} \times 100\% = 40\% \][/tex]
So, the percent change is a 40% increase.
3. The percent change from 250 to 60 is calculated as follows:
[tex]\[ \text{Percent Change} = \left( \frac{60 - 250}{250} \right) \times 100\% = \left( \frac{-190}{250} \right) \times 100\% = -76\% \][/tex]
So, the percent change is a 76% decrease.
4. The percent change from 60 to 99 is calculated as follows:
[tex]\[ \text{Percent Change} = \left( \frac{99 - 60}{60} \right) \times 100\% = \left( \frac{39}{60} \right) \times 100\% = \frac{13}{20} \times 100\% = 65\% \][/tex]
So, the percent change is a 65% increase.
An industrial designer wants to determine the average amount of time it takes an adult to assemble an “easy to assemble” toy. A sample of 16 times yielded an average time of 19.9 minutes, with a sample standard deviation of 6 minutes. Assuming normality of assembly times, provide a 90% confidence interval for the mean assembly time.
Answer:
(17.42 ; 22.38)
Step-by-step explanation:
To construct a confidence interval we use the following formula:
ci = (sample mean) +- z*(sd)/[n^(1/2)]
The sample mean is 19.9 and the standard deviation is 6. The sample has a n of 16. We have to find the value of z which is the upper (1-C)/2 critical value for the standard normal distribution. Here, as we want a confidence interval at a 90% we have (1-C)/2=0.05 we have to look at the 1-0.05=0.95 value at the normal distribution table, which is 1.65 approximately. Replacing all these values:
ci: (sample mean - z*(sd)/[n^(1/2)] ; sample mean + z*(sd)/[n^(1/2)])
ci: (19.9 - 1.65*6/[16^(1/2)] ; 19.9 + 1.65*6/[16^(1/2)])
ci: (19.9 - 9.9/4] ; 19.9 + 9.9/4)
ci: (19.9 - 2.48 ; 19.9 + 2.48)
ci: (17.42 ; 22.38)
